Â   CONSTRUCTION FACTS AND PURPOSE OF THE APPIAN WAY It has been already mentioned that this distant pathway i. e. the Appian Way was built for a specific purpose of serving the war requirements of the Roman army. Thus, the overall construction of this road required the utility of high quality of raw materials and appropriate implementation of strategic plans. In addition, the Appian Way was also built to cater multiple trade practices and VIP travels during the period when Roman economy got subjected to a depletion stage. The primitive stage of this distant route construction was funded by the Roman Empire. However, with time, the cost burden associated with such construction eventually got shifted upon the findings as generated by the activities of this nation’s population6. As a part of the construction plan, multiple mountainous areas were leveled down and reinforced bridges were constructed on the rivers. In order to continue the roadway expansion, the expertise Roman engineers were made a part of the Roman army and the t roops within the army were assigned the roles of being workforce for such projects.
